Taxon Profile
Version: 0.3-RELEASE-2018_11_10 (10 November 2018)
Bioschemas profile for describing a biological taxon

| Property | Expected Type | Description | CD | Controlled Vocabulary | Example | 
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Marginality: Minimum. | |||||
| @context | URL | Used to provide the context (namespaces) for the JSON-LD file.  Not needed in other serialisations.  | 
    ONE | ||
| @type | Text | Schema.org/Bioschemas class for the resource declared using JSON-LD syntax. For other serialisations please use the appropriate mechanism. While it is permissible to provide multiple types, it is preferred to use a single type.  | 
    MANY | Schema.org, Bioschemas | |
| @id | IRI | Used to distinguish the resource being described in JSON-LD. For other serialisations use the appropriate approach. | ONE | ||
| dct:conformsTo | IRI | Used to state the Bioschemas profile that the markup relates to. The versioned URL of the profile must be used. Note that we use a CURIE in the table here but the full URL for Dublin Core terms must be used in the markup (http://purl.org/dc/terms/conformsTo), see example.  | 
    ONE | Bioschemas profile versioned URL | |
| name | 
                Text | 
            
                Schema:  The name of the item. Bioschemas: Taxon name without authorship nor date information of the currently valid (zoological) or accepted (botanical) taxon.  | 
            ONE | ||
| Marginality: Recommended. | |||||
| parentTaxon | 
                Taxon Text URL  | 
            
                Schema:  Closest parent taxon of the taxon in question. Inverse property: childTaxon Bioschemas: Direct, most proximate higher-rank parent taxon  | 
            ONE | ||
| taxonRank | 
                PropertyValue Text URL  | 
            
                Schema:  The taxonomic rank of this taxon given preferably as a URI from a controlled vocabulary (typically the ranks from TDWG TaxonRank ontology or equivalent Wikidata URIs)  | 
            MANY | ||
| url | 
                URL | 
            
                Schema:  URL of the item. Bioschemas: Link to the webpage associated to this taxon  | 
            ONE | ||
| Marginality: Optional. | |||||
| additionalType | 
                URL | 
            
                Schema:  An additional type for the item, typically used for adding more specific types from external vocabularies in microdata syntax. This is a relationship between something and a class that the thing is in. In RDFa syntax, it is better to use the native RDFa syntax - the ‘typeof’ attribute - for multiple types. Schema.org tools may have only weaker understanding of extra types, in particular those defined externally. Bioschemas: A Taxon type from a well known vocabulary, e.g. DarwinCore http://rs.tdwg.org/dwc/terms/Taxon or http://rs.tdwg.org/ontology/voc/TaxonConcept#TaxonConcept  | 
            MANY | ||
| alternateName | 
                Text | 
            
                Schema:  An alias for the item. Bioschemas: Scientific name, possibly including authorship and date information, of a synonym of the currently valid (zoological) or accepted (botanical) taxon.  | 
            MANY | ||
| childTaxon | 
                Taxon Text URL  | 
            
                Schema:  Closest child taxa of the taxon in question. Inverse property: parentTaxon Bioschemas: Direct, most proximate lower-rank child taxa  | 
            MANY | ||
| hasCategoryCode | 
                CategoryCode | 
            
                Schema:  A Category code contained in this code set.  | 
            MANY | ||
| sameAs | 
                URL | 
            
                Schema:  URL of a reference Web page that unambiguously indicates the item’s identity. E.g. the URL of the item’s Wikipedia page, Wikidata entry, or official website. Bioschemas: URL of third-party webpages describing the same taxon  | 
            MANY | ||
| scientificName | 
                Text | 
            
                Bioschemas:  Full scientific name, with authorship and date information if know, of the currently valid (zoological) or accepted (botanical) taxon.  | 
            ONE | ||
| scientificNameAuthorship | 
                Text | 
            
                Bioschemas:  Authorship information for the scientificName formatted according to the conventions of the applicable nomenclatural Code. Example: “(Torr.) J.T. Howell”, “(Martinovský) Tzvelev”, “(Györfi, 1952)”  | 
            ONE | ||
| vernacularName | 
                Text | 
            
                Bioschemas:  A vernacular (common) name of the taxon  | 
            MANY | ||
